Iceland: Listen to The “Söngvakeppnin 2025” Songs

Icelandic broadcaster RUV has announced the “Söngvakeppnin 2025″ (The Icelandic National Selection for Eurovision 2025) participants.

You can listen to the songs, by the semi-final split:

Semi-Final 1 (February 8th)

  1. BIRGO  Ég flýg í storming / Stormchaser
  2. Ágúst – Eins og þú / Like You
  3. Stebbi JAK  Frelsið Mitt / Set Me Free
  4. BIA – Norðurljós / Northern Lights
  5. VÆB – RÓA

Semi-Final 2 (February 15th)

  1. Bjarni Arason – Aðeins lengur
  2. Dagur Sig – Flugdrekar / Carousel
  3. Tinna – Þrá / Words
  4. Bára Katrín – Rísum upp / Rise Above
  5. Júlí & Dísa – Eldur / Fire

“Söngvakeppnin 2025” – Known Details

  1. Benedikt Valsson, Guðrún Dís Emilsdóttir and Fannar Sveinsso will host the shows.
  2. The national selection will feature 3 shows:
    • Semi-Final 1: Saturday, February 8th 2025
    • Semi-Final 2: Saturday, February 15th 2025
    • Grand Final: Saturday, February 22nd 2025
  3. The shows will be held in RVK Studios in Gufunes.
  4. 10 artists were shortlisted to compete in the televised shows.
  5. 5 artists will perform in each semi-final, 3 of them will qualify (based on 100% public vote)
  6. 6 artists will compete in the final. The grand final results will be determined by one round only, composed of a 50% jury vote (featuring 7 international members) and a 50% public vote.
  7. The main changes compared to previous years are:
    • No wildcard will be given to one of the semi-final non-qualifiers
    • The number of finalists increased from 5 to 6
    • The “super-final” in cancelled.
  8. The songs and the artists will be revealed on January 17th.
  9. Thomas Benstem and Selma Björnsdóttir will be the artistic director of the contest.

Eurovision 2025 will be held in Basel, Switzerland on the 13th, 15th, and 17th of May 2025
